Transaction 62757372719c69cef6c652764054dd19ff785f31e9376a30551e8971e01c95cc

1 Input
2 Outputs
  • 62757372719c69cef6c652764054dd19ff785f31e9376a30551e8971e01c95cc:0
  • value  9721873
    address  33zvFMVYduHrnvsqAa26YyyNzTd9XCMHb5
  • 62757372719c69cef6c652764054dd19ff785f31e9376a30551e8971e01c95cc:1
  • value  357406
    address  18cCkXZqLoDKPTEGYvAxhg7cTcTYHC7dr6